}


/*
   This is part of the NCS (New Combat System).

   This NCS function will accept the information about a combat event and
   calculate the attack and defense modifiers for both units -- taking into
   account unit types, terrain, stacking, and the global handicap values of
   the two players.
*/

void NCS_combat_mods(attacker, defender, att_mod, def_mod)
struct Unit *attacker, *defender;
int *att_mod, *def_mod;
{
   int terrain = get(t_grid,defender->col,defender->row);
   int atype = attacker->type;
   int dtype = defender->type;

   // I can do this shortcut because airfields defend like infantry in
   // every respect; of course it is only changed locally in this function!
   if (dtype==AIRFIELD)
      dtype = RIFLE;

   // start with the global handicap values of the players
   *att_mod = roster[attacker->owner].att;
   *def_mod = roster[defender->owner].def;

   // transports always have a -4 on defense
   if (dtype==TRANSPORT)
      *def_mod -= 4;

   // transports and carriers have a -4 on attack
   if (atype==TRANSPORT || atype==CARRIER)
      *att_mod -= 4;

   // carriers have a -2 defense and -1 for every 2 fighters on board
   if (dtype==CARRIER) {
      *def_mod -= 2;
      {      // count units on board
         int ctr = 0;
         struct Unit *unit = (struct Unit *)unit_list.mlh_Head;
         for (; unit->unode.mln_Succ; unit = (struct Unit *)unit->unode.mln_Succ)
            if (unit->ship==defender) ctr++;
         *def_mod -= ctr/2;
      }
   }

   // submarines have a basic -3 defense
   if (dtype==SUB)
      *def_mod -= 3;

   // fighters & bombers have a +3 defending against ships
   if (dtype==FIGHTER || dtype==BOMBER)
      if (wishbook[atype].ship_flag)
         *def_mod += 3;

   // fighters have a +3 attack against bombers or aircav
   if (dtype==BOMBER || dtype==AIRCAV)
      if (atype==FIGHTER)
         *att_mod += 3;

   /*
      ground units defending:
         -3 against naval bombardment
         -2 against bombers
         -1 against other aircraft
   */
   if (dtype==RIFLE || dtype==ARMOR) {
      switch (dtype) {
         case CRUISER:
         case BATTLESHIP:
            *def_mod--;
         case BOMBER:
            *def_mod--;
         case FIGHTER:
         case AIRCAV:
            *def_mod--;
      }
   }

   /* That takes care of the unit-based modifiers.  Now the terrain stuff! */
   switch (terrain) {

      case HEX_DESERT:
         // ground forces -2 defense against aircraft
         if (dtype==RIFLE || dtype==ARMOR)
            if (wishbook[atype].range>0)
               *def_mod -= 2;
         // infantry -2 defense against armor
         if (dtype==RIFLE && atype==ARMOR)
            *def_mod -= 2;
         break;

      case HEX_BRUSH:
         // ground forces +1 defense against fighters or bombers
         if (dtype==RIFLE || dtype==ARMOR)
            if (atype==FIGHTER || atype==BOMBER)
               *def_mod++;
         break;

      case HEX_FOREST:
         // ground forces +2 defense against fighters or bombers
         if (dtype==RIFLE || dtype==ARMOR)
            if (atype==FIGHTER || atype==BOMBER)
               *def_mod += 2;
         // infantry +2 defense against armor
         if (dtype==RIFLE && atype==ARMOR)
            *def_mod += 2;
         // armor -2 defense against infantry
         if (dtype==ARMOR && atype==RIFLE)
            *def_mod -= 2;
         break;

      case HEX_JUNGLE:
         // ground forces +3 defense against fighters or bombers
         if (dtype==RIFLE || dtype==ARMOR)
            if (atype==FIGHTER || atype==BOMBER)
               *def_mod += 3;
         // infantry +3 defense against armor
         if (dtype==RIFLE && atype==ARMOR)
            *def_mod += 3;
         // armor -3 defense against infantry
         if (dtype==ARMOR && atype==RIFLE)
            *def_mod -= 3;
         break;

      case HEX_SWAMP:
         // ground forces +1 defense against aircraft
         if (dtype==RIFLE || dtype==ARMOR)
            if (wishbook[atype].range>0)
               *def_mod++;
         // infantry +2 defense against armor shelling
         if (dtype==RIFLE && atype==ARMOR)
            *def_mod += 2;
         break;

      case HEX_RUGGED:
         // ground forces, +1 defending against fighter or bomber
         if (dtype==RIFLE || dtype==ARMOR)
            if (atype==FIGHTER || atype==BOMBER)
               *def_mod++;
         break;

      case HEX_HILLS:
         // ground forces, +2 defending against fighter or bomber
         // ground forces, +1 defending against cruiser or battleship
         if (dtype==RIFLE || dtype==ARMOR) {
            if (atype==FIGHTER || atype==BOMBER)
               *def_mod += 2;
            if (atype==CRUISER || atype==BATTLESHIP)
               *def_mod += 1;
         }
         break;

      case HEX_MOUNTAINS:
         // ground forces, +3 defending against fighter or bomber
         // ground forces, +2 defending against air cavalry
         // ground forces, +2 defending against cruiser or battleship
         if (dtype==RIFLE || dtype==ARMOR) {
            if (atype==FIGHTER || atype==BOMBER)
               *def_mod += 3;
            if (atype==AIRCAV)
               *def_mod += 2;
            if (atype==CRUISER || atype==BATTLESHIP)
               *def_mod += 2;
         }
         // infantry defending +3 against armor shelling
         if (dtype==RIFLE && atype==ARMOR)
            *def_mod += 3;
         break;

      case HEX_SHALLOWS:
         // subs attack -3 against ships
         if (atype==SUB && wishbook[dtype].ship_flag)
            *att_mod -= 3;
         // subs defend -2 (on top of the -3 they already have!)
         if (dtype==SUB)
            *def_mod -= 2;
         // all other ships defend at -1 in shallows
         if (wishbook[dtype].ship_flag && dtype!=SUB)
            *def_mod--;
         break;

      case HEX_DEPTH:
         // sub defends at +3 in depths
         if (dtype==SUB)
            *def_mod += 3;
         break;
   }
}

/*
   This function determines the cargo capacity of a ship.  It returns the
   maximum number of units the ship can carry in its current condition
   (taking damage into account), NOT the amount of free space on the ship.

   Depending on the value you want, use the formulas:
      free_space=cargo_capacity(ship)-ship->cargo;
   or
      free_space=cargo_capacity(ship)-ship->weight;  // taking heavy armor into account

   The function also returns a -1 if the unit specified is not a cargo vessel,
   so it can be used to quickly check that as well.
*/
int cargo_capacity(ship)
struct Unit *ship;
{
   int capacity;

   switch (ship->type) {
      case TRANSPORT:
         capacity = 6;
         break;
      case CARRIER:
         capacity = 8;
         break;
      default:
         return -1;
   }
   capacity -= ship->damage*2;   // each hit reduces capacity by two units
   return capacity;
}


/*
   This function returns the weight (for loading/unloading purposes) of a given
   type of cargo.  It appears simple to the point of redundancy right now, but it
   could easily become more complex as the stacking & transporting rules are
   tinkered with.
*/

int cargo_weight(type)
int type;
{
   int weight;

   switch (type) {
      case RIFLE:
      case FIGHTER:
         weight = 1;
         break;
      case ARMOR:
         weight = 2;
         break;
      default:
         weight = 100;  // an impossibly high value
   }
   return weight;
}
